Transaction dfaa3cb45b7f5566ebe65080892e7576e871e345148644eff49541084284fa3e

block
6f9adc169220f2b8622365317aadd7d68fa6528b1fe38ff5afecf7d18c16b0c0

50 Inputs

37 Outputs